Ethical Frameworks and Data Disclosure in Drone Missions

The collection of vast amounts of data—often highly sensitive—is a core function of many non-profit drone operations. This necessitates robust ethical frameworks and clear data disclosure policies.

Data Collection and Privacy Policies

When drones equipped with high-resolution cameras, thermal imaging, or even FPV systems operate in populated areas or gather data on vulnerable populations, privacy becomes paramount. Non-profits must disclose their policies regarding data collection, storage, and usage. This includes:

  • Consent Mechanisms: How consent is obtained from individuals or communities whose data might be captured.
  • Anonymization Procedures: Methods used to anonymize or de-identify sensitive data.
  • Data Retention Policies: How long data is stored and under what conditions it is deleted.
  • Data Access and Sharing Agreements: Who has access to the collected data, for what purposes, and under what conditions it might be shared with partners, researchers, or the public.
    Organizations might publish concise privacy policies specifically tailored to their drone operations on their websites, making them easily accessible to affected communities and the general public.

Disclosure of AI and Algorithmic Use

Non-profits leveraging AI follow modes for autonomous data capture, or employing machine learning algorithms for processing mapping data (e.g., identifying specific plant species from multispectral imagery, detecting signs of distress in disaster zones), face a unique disclosure challenge. Transparency around AI tools involves:

  • Algorithmic Bias: Disclosing efforts to mitigate potential biases in AI models, especially when decisions or analyses could impact human populations.
  • Model Explainability: Providing simplified explanations of how AI models arrive at their conclusions, particularly in critical applications like predictive analysis for resource allocation.
  • Data Provenance: Documenting the source and nature of the data used to train AI models, ensuring ethical sourcing and representation.
    This form of disclosure builds confidence in the integrity and fairness of AI-driven outcomes, which is crucial for tech & innovation in the public interest.

Flight Operation Disclosures

For non-profits conducting regular or extensive drone missions, disclosing operational details is a vital form of accountability. This might include:

  • Mission Statements and Objectives: Clearly articulating the purpose and goals of specific drone operations.
  • Operational Areas and Flight Paths: Informing local communities or relevant authorities about where and when drones will be flying, particularly for extensive mapping or remote sensing projects.
  • Safety Protocols: Publishing comprehensive safety manuals, risk assessment procedures, and pilot certification details to assure stakeholders of safe and compliant operations. This aligns with standard aviation practices and reinforces responsible use.
  • Regulatory Compliance Documentation: While often submitted directly to aviation authorities (e.g., FAA in the US), non-profits may choose to publicly acknowledge their adherence to national and international drone regulations, showcasing their commitment to legal and safe airspace integration.
